The phrase "most runic" can be replaced by a number of alternative words, depending on the context in which it is used. For example, "most symbolic" may be suitable if referring to a piece of writing that is highly charged with metaphorical or allegorical meaning. "Most mystical" could be used if the writing is thought to possess some kind of spiritual or supernatural power. "Most inscrutable" might be a good choice if the writing is highly complex or difficult to understand. Alternatively, "most archaic" may be appropriate if the writing is very old and belongs to a remote period in history.
